Which of the following correctly orders C-C bond lengths from longest to shortest?

Detailed Explanation
Bond length decreases with increasing bond order: single bond (C-C) is longest (~1.54 Å), double bond (C=C) is intermediate (~1.34 Å), triple bond (C≡C) is shortest (~1.20 Å).
